Removal and installation the distribution block



Removal the distribution block



1. Disconnect the negative battery terminal.

Attention:
  • To prevent atmospheric moisture from entering the air conditioning system circuit, it is necessary to immediately plug any openings in the air conditioning system components. Fuel line plugs can be used for this purpose (catalog numbers 7 701 208 229 or 7 701 476 857). The plugs must be clean. Do not use plugs that have already been used to plug fuel lines.
  • To avoid refrigerant leaks, be careful not to damage (do not deform, twist, etc.) pipelines.


2. Disconnect the connecting pipes from the expansion valve.

3. Move the expansion valve connecting pipes to the side.

4. Seal the openings of the connecting pipes and the expansion valve with plugs.



5. Clamp the pipes with clamps (Ms. 583) (5).

5. Clamp the pipes with clamps (Ms. 583) (5).


6. Remove the clamps (6) of the heater hoses.

7. Disconnect the heater hoses.

8. Remove the instrument panel.

9. Remove the front air ducts.

10. Shine the steering column.

11. Disconnect the wiring from the holders (7), (8), (9) and (10).

11. Disconnect the wiring from the holders (7), (8), (9) and (10).


11. Disconnect the wiring from the holders (7), (8), (9) and (10).


12. Disconnect the connector (11).



12. Disconnect the connector (11).


13. Disconnect the distribution block connector.

14. Remove the front footwell air ducts.

15. Disconnect the connectors (12) from the control panel.

15. Disconnect the connectors (12) from the control panel.


16. Disconnect the radiator fan connector.

17. Disconnect the heater resistor connector.

18. Disconnect the modular fan speed variator connector.

19. Using a special station, remove the refrigerant from the air conditioning system.

20. Remove the distribution block.

21. Remove the control panel, recirculation flap drive cable, air distribution flap drive cable, mixing flap drive cable, fan assembly, fan speed variator module, heater resistor, heater core lines, heater core, evaporator ring, evaporator sensor and expansion valve from the distribution block.



Installation of the distribution block



Attention:
  • Remove the plugs from each component at the very last moment, just before installation. Also remove components from their packaging just before installation.
  • To avoid leaks, ensure that all seals and pipe surfaces are in good condition, clean and free of cracks.


1. Clean the refrigerant line seals.

2. Install all components in the reverse order of removal.

3. Using a special station, fill the air conditioning system circuit with the required amount of refrigerant and compressor oil.

4. Fill and bleed the engine cooling system.

5. Check the tightness of the engine cooling system.

6. Check the tightness of the air conditioning system circuit.

7. Check the functionality of the air conditioning system.
